    NVIDIA’s AI Factories are designed to speed up AI and HPC workloads! At their core is the Digital Twin, a physics-based model used to design, validate, and operate factories optimized for tokens per watt across GPUs, cooling, power, and control systems. We are looking for an intern to support hands-on thermal R&D, evaluate, and model data centers' energy flows and waste heat recovery systems.

    What You Will Be Doing:

    + Research and evaluate waste heat recovery technologies such as absorption chillers, heat-recovery loops, and their energy/computing impacts.

    + Model data center energy flows, PUE/RP improvements, and high-temperature liquid-cooling benefits.

    + Create digital twins using CFD and FNM tools for ambient-to-chip thermal/fluid simulations.

    + Assist with analysis, scripting, and visualization (Python/MATLAB), and supporting technical reports and benchmarking.

    +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ure alignment with sustainability and performance goals.

    What We Need to See:

    + Currently pursuing a Master's or Ph.D. degree in Mechanical Engineering with a strong thermal and optimization background.

    + Strong understanding of thermal management principles and fluid dynamics.

    + In-depth knowledge of sustainable technologies, including waste heat recovery, advanced cooling solutions, energy-efficient hardware, and innovative data center designs.

    + Understanding of industry standards and regulatory requirements related to environmental sustainability.

    Ways to Stand Out from the crowd:

    + Experience with DCs cooling systems simulation tools (CFD and FNM).

    + Experience with Omniverse or USD-based digital twin integration.

    + Research/publications in data center cooling or advanced thermal management.

    + Strong communication and partnership skills.
